将 2 个数学字体组合在一起

将 2 个数学字体组合在一起

我想使用pxfonts包作为我的文档中的主要数学字体。

但是我还需要fourier包来使用\wideOarc命令。

有没有什么办法可以把这些数学字体结合起来?非常感谢 :)

\documentclass[11pt,oneside]{article} 
\usepackage[utf8]{vietnam}
\usepackage{fourier}
\usepackage{pxfonts}
\begin{document}
$\wideOarc{AB}$
\end{document}

答案1

您可以使其\wideOarc可访问(所有需要的信息都在fourier.sty):

\documentclass[11pt,oneside]{article} 
\usepackage[utf8]{vietnam}
\usepackage{fourier}
\usepackage{pxfonts}

\DeclareSymbolFont{largesymbols}{FMX}{futm}{m}{n}
\DeclareMathAccent{\wideOarc}{\mathord}{largesymbols}{228}

\begin{document}
$\wideOarc{AB}$
\end{document}

enter image description here

简要说明(有关详细信息,请参阅终端中的fntguide.pdf可用使用)。texdoc fntguide.pdf

\DeclareMathAccent{<cmd>}{<type>}{<sym-font>}{<slot>}

定义<cmd>为数学重音符号。重音符号来自<slot>中的插槽<sym-font><type>可以是\mathord\mathalpha;在后一种情况下,重音符号在数学字母表中使用时会改变字体。

\DeclareSymbolFont{<sym-font>}{<encoding>}{<family>}{<series>}{<shape>}

将创建具有此名称的新符号字体。参数<encoding><family>和用于设置或重置所有数学版本中此符号字体的默认值。命令<series><shape>

相关内容